Israel Adsania's meteoric rise to the UFC skies got stuck in the night barrier (Saturday and Sunday) - and not just any, but a major Polish obstacle.
Jan Belchovich unanimously defeated (49-46, 49-45, 49-45) Adsania, who had been unbeaten until tonight - on his way to retaining the semi-heavyweight title in the UFC 259 main event.
Adsania, the middleweight UFC champion, tried to become the fifth fighter in UFC history to hold two titles at the same time, but as mentioned the attempt was unsuccessful.

For Belchovich (8:28) it was the fifth victory in a row.
The 38-year-old Pole holds the title of semi-heavyweight since defeating Dominic Rice in September 2020 at UFC 253. Overall, he has won 9 of his last 10 fights and experienced a kind of late-career blossoming.

Adsania (1:20) a former kickboxing champion, won his first nine fights in the UFC until tonight's fight.
The 31-year-old Nigerian of Nigerian descent has recorded 15 knockout victories out of the 20 he has in his career, and has served as a middleweight champion since October 2019.
